(2) Description l
'L li The packaging consists of a right circular cylinder with a henispherical l
gl l
botton.
It has a maxinun outside diameter of 16 inches at the hast.
I It The cask itself has an outside diameter of 8 inches.
The nverall l
I ll l
height is 15-1/4 inches.
Inner cavity dinensions are 3.120 inches in i
diameter by 6-1/2 inches high.
Shielding is composed of a 2-inch l
thick isostatically oressed and sintered tungsten alloy containing 95%
i gi tunqsten, 3.5% nickel, and 1.5% f ron, with a 1/4-inch type 304L t
('
stainless steel cladding outside and a 1/8-inch type 304L stainless
,1 l
I steel cladding inside.
The gasketed lid consists of a 150-pound I
I l'
flange to which the top shield plug is attached and is held in place
[
by eight S/8-inch studs and bolts.
A capped 1-inch pipe is welded to l
the underside of the cesk lid to position the contents.
The gross g
weight of the basic cask is 381 pounds.
1; j!
l I
ll A tungsten insert personnel shield and shipping pallet are used for I
3 ll shipping radioactive materials having higher internal heat loads and I
l' external radiation levels.
The gross weight of the cask, insert, heat g
f shield, and skid is 565 pounds, t
I ji ll (3) Drawings I
I l'
I 1
The packaging is constructed in accordance with Oak Ridge National l
Laboratory Drawings No fi-11575-E'i-001-E-Pev. 3, X3D-ll575-002 Rev. O, l
and X3D-11575-003 Rev. 4.

9 (b) Contents l
(1) Type and fom of material
(
V Solid radioactive material which will not decompose at temperatures of n
250*F (121*C) or less, encapsulated in a mtal capsule which neets the k
requirements of special fom radioactive naterial.
(2) Maxinun quantity of material per package h
v Not to exceed SN themal decay heat.
F 9
8 6.
For naterial described in 5(b)(1) and limited in 5(b)(?), the cask nust be nounted to the shipping pellet, the personnel shield rust be in place, the
(
tungsten insert rust be positioned in the cask cavity, and the special fom p
contents must be held within the tungsten insert by a spacer that will assure k
the shielded position for nomal conditions of transport.
R k
8 7.
For the material described in 5(b)(1) but limited to no more than ?5w per package of themal decay, heat, the shipping callet, personnel shield, and the tungsten l
insert need not be used.
t k
8.
Prior to each shiprent, the package and qaskets will he inspected.
The gaskets p
shall be replaced with new gaskets if any defects are noted. Gaskets rust be replaced not more than 6 nonths prior to any shipment.
l 9.
Prior to each shipment, the package shall be leak tested to 10' at.cm /sec 3
usino the soap bubble test or equivalent, e
I 3
- 10. Within 6 nonths prior to shionent, package welds will receive a dye penetrant i ns pection. Repairs will be nade as appropriate.
l
- 11. The package authorized by this certificate is hereby approved for use under the p
gencral license provisions of 10 CFR $71.12.
